A Mother's Story Starring Pokwang – Movie Poster, Cast Photos and Trailer Released

Top-Comedienne Pokwang finally lands a solo lead star role in silver screen via “A Mother’s Story”!
 

“A Mother’s Story“ is not a comedy movie but a purely family-drama. Yap! Pokwang takes on a dramatic role for this film! It’s a story of an OFW name Medy (portrayed by Pokwang), an illegal immigrant in the US working and striving to earn money for her children in the Philippines.
 
Also starring in the movie are Rayver Cruz, Xriel Manbat, Beth Tamayo, Daria Ramirez, Nonie Buencamino, Ana Capri, Jaime Fabregas, Aaron Junatas, K Brosas and with special participation of Atty. Michael J. Gurfinkel.
 

Directed by John-D J. Lazatin, produced by The Filipino Channel and distributed by ABS-CBN International and Star Cinema, “A Mother’s Story” opens in theaters nationwide on January 8, 2012.
 

The film has already premiered in several states in US like California and Nevada; London, Milan and other countries around the world for our “Pinoy Kababayans” out there.

Plot/Sypnosis

"Medy (Pokwang), a make-up artist, was given the chance of a lifetime to accompany a concert star to the United States for a performance. She promised her family that she will return after a week. However, while in America, she stumbled upon a former classmate Helen (Beth Tamayo) who convinced her to stay for good in the land of milk and honey. She initially refused, but eventually gave in, when she got a call one night from her husband that they need a big amount of money to bring her youngest daughter to the hospital. America has not been the friendliest to her and our story begins with her coming home to Manila literally with nothing. Medy’s two kids, King (Rayver Cruz) and Queenie (Xyriel Manabat) are now 19 and 7. King struggles with the return of his mother. Animosity, resentment, shame, and anger are issues he has built with Medy. For the young Queenie, it’s getting to know Nanay… who she thought would one day come out of a Balikbayan Box. And as for her husband, Medy discovers something she least expected.

How will Medy put her life and that of her family’s back together, now that she’s back after 7 long years?

'Enteng Ng Ina Mo' Leads First Day of MMFF Box-Office Race with a Record-Breaking P38.5-M

Enteng Ng Ina Mo is breaking all records in MMFF opening day history!


As expected, “Enteng Ng Ina Mo,” a fantasy-comedy film starring two Box Office Comedy Royalties, Vic Sotto and Ai Ai delas Alas, topped the 2011 MMFF box-office race on its opening day. The said movie was grossed P38.5 million- a new record to beat after successfully exceeding the P31 million opening ticket sales of another fantasy film “Si Agimat at Si Enteng Kabisote” (2010).
 
Meanwhile, Bong Revilla’s “Panday 2” came in second with P20 million followed by Kris Aquino’s “Segunda Mano” with P18.25 million.

Here is the first day gross of MMFF 2011 entries:

1. Enteng Ng Ina Mo – P38.5 million
2. Panday 2 – P20 million
3. Segunda Mano – P18.25 million
4. My Househusband – P17.33 million
5. Shake Rattle & Roll 13 – P15.9 million
6. Yesterday, Today and Tomorrow – P10.1M million
7. Manila Kingpin: The Untold Story of Asiong Salonga – P3 million

Notably that this year’s overall first day gross are much higher/better than last year.

2010 MMFF (1st Day)
1. Si Agimat at Si Enteng Kabisote – P31 million
2. Ang Tanging Ina, Last Na ‘To – P20 million
3. Dalaw – P12.5 million
4. Shake Rattle & Roll XII – P11.8 million
5. RPG: Metanoia – P5.1 million
6. Super Inday and the Golden Bibe – P4.7 million
7. Rosario – P3.2 million
8. Father Jejemon – P1.4 million

Yam Laranas’ ‘The Road’ Hits P31.24-M in 2 weeks

GMA Films' latest thriller, “The Road” registered a box-office gross of P31.24 million in 2 weeks.
 

Aside with the romantic-comedy flick “Won’t Last a Day Without You”, Yam Laranas’ latest horror film The Road was also doing well at the Box Office. As of December 11, it has grossed P31.24 million on its 2nd week of screening in 60 major movie theaters in the country (click HERE to see the full figures).
 
The Road is now at no. 16 in the list of top-grossing Pinoy films for 2011. The movie is projected to have a final box-office receipt of P40-M+ before the opening of MMFF this December 25.

HIGHEST-GROSSING PINOY FILMS FOR 2011
 (As of December 11, 2011)

1. The Unkabogable Praybeyt Benjamin - P331.63-M
2. No Other Woman – P276.80M
3. Catch Me…I’m In Love – P120.21M
4. In the Name of Love – P117.2M
5. Pak! Pak! My Dr. Kwak! – P72.31M
6. Bulong – P67.27M
7. Won't Last a Day Without You - P65.29-M (2 Weeks)
8. Temptation Island – P60-M
9. Who’s That Girl? – P58.31M
10. Forever and a Day – P44.73M
11. My Valentine Girls – P44.26M
12. Wedding Tayo, Wedding Hindi – P37.46M
13. Zombadings 1: Patayin sa Shokot si Remington – P32.28-M
14. Tween Academy: Class of 2012 – P32.23M
15. Aswang – P31.28-M
16. The Road – P31.24-M (2 weeks)
17. Ang Babae sa Septic Tank – P30.26M
18. My Neighbor’s Wife – P27.56M
19. Way Back Home – P25.78-M
20. The Adventures of Pureza: Queen of the Riles – P19.84-M
21. Tumbok – P10.53M
22. Ikaw ang Pag-ibig – P5.5M
23. Tum: My Pledge of Love – P5.16M
24. Thelma – P1.35M

‘Manila Kingpin: The Untold Story of Asiong Salonga’ – Movie Poster, Synopsis and Full Trailer

Pinoy action film is back! Scenema Concept International and Viva Films are proudly to present a classic action film this Christmas “Manila Kingpin: The Asiong Salonga Story”.
 

Manila Kingpin is an official entry to the 37th Metro Manila Film Festival starring Jeorge “E.R.” Estregan (in the title role), Carla Abellana and Phillip Salvador.
 

A Screenplay by Roy Iglesias/ Rey Ventura and helmed by Tikoy Aguiluz, the movie also stars Baron Geisler, Yul Servo, Dennis Padilla, Ketchup Eusebio, Ping Medina, Amay Bisaya, Gerard Ejercito, and Jerico Ejercito.
 



Synopsis:

Tondo. The Ancient Gangland. Year 1950. Gwangwars were in. Violence was the name of the game. Gangsters carried Thompson's and grease guns in a Bayong. Police Characters were just too tough resulting in bloody encounters.All notorious hoodlums dreamt to be the King.

But one smart and slippery hoodlum rose to power and reigned as King. He was the youngest and toughest Public Enemy No. 1 (Criminal) the Tondo Underworld ever bred. He was feared, respected and loved. A legendary Robin Hood in his time Tondo will never forget. His gang called him Hitler. Tondo remembers him by another name.ASIONG SALONGA

He robbed the rich to give to the poor. He lived and died by the gun. He lived fast and died young.This is his bloody career and salvage true-to-life story.

'The Unkabogable Praybeyt Benjamin' Grosses P318.49-M in 3 Weeks, 'Aswang' Hits P29-M in 2 Weeks

The comedy filmThe Unkabogable Praybeyt Benjamin” successfully breaks the box office record of the adult-drama movieNo Other Woman”.
 

As of November 13, the Vice Ganda starrer grossed P318.49 million on its 3rd week of showing in 110 theaters nationwide making the comedy film the highest-grossing Filipino movie of all time and the first one to reach the P300 million mark! Wow!
 
The Unkabogable Praybeyt Benjamin has broken the outstanding tickets sales of current leader “No Other Woman” amounting P276 million. Both films are co-production of Star Cinema and Viva Films. In fact, the comedy film also surpassed the record (here in the Phil.) of the foreign film “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ows Part 2″ which had a box-office gross of P295.96-M.

TOP 5-GROSSING FILMS IN THE PHILIPPINES FOR 2011
(As of November 13, 2011)

1. Transformers: Dark of Moon – P415.74-M
2. Praybeyt Benjamin – P318.49-M (3 weeks)
3.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ows Part 2 – P295.96-M
4. No Other Woman – P276.8-M
5. Kung Fu Panda 2 – P198.24M

 
 
Meanwhile, the horror pinoy film from Regal films, “Aswang” starring Lovi Poe earns P29 million in 2 weeks. The film is now on 15th place in the list of Highest-Grossing Pinoy Films for 2011.

HIGHEST-GROSSING PINOY FILMS FOR 2011
 (As of November 13, 2011)

1. The Unkabogable Praybeyt Benjamin - P318.49-M (3 weeks)
2. No Other Woman – P276.80M
3. Catch Me…I’m In Love – P120.21M
4. In the Name of Love – P117.2M
5. Pak! Pak! My Dr. Kwak! – P72.31M
6. Bulong – P67.27M
7. Temptation Island – P60-M
8. Who’s That Girl? – P58.31M
9. Forever and a Day – P44.73M
10. My Valentine Girls – P44.26M
11. Wedding Tayo, Wedding Hindi – P37.46M
12. Zombadings 1: Patayin sa Shokot si Remington – P32.28-M
13. Tween Academy: Class of 2012 – P32.23M
14. Ang Babae sa Septic Tank – P30.26M
15. Aswang - P29-M (2 weeks)
16. My Neighbor’s Wife – P27.56M
17. Way Back Home – P25.78-M
18. The Adventures of Pureza: Queen of the Riles – P19.84-M
19. Tumbok – P10.53M
20. Ikaw ang Pag-ibig – P5.5M
21. Tum: My Pledge of Love – P5.16M
22. Thelma – P1.35M
